首页 快讯文章正文

PHP网站部署全攻略,从搭建到上线,一步步教你轻松完成,PHP网站部署指南,从搭建到上线一站式教程

快讯 2025年11月29日 15:10 7 admin

随着互联网的快速发展,PHP作为一门流行的服务器端脚本语言,已经广泛应用于各种网站的开发,PHP网站的部署并非易事,涉及到众多环节,本文将为您详细讲解PHP网站的部署过程,从搭建环境到上线,让您轻松完成PHP网站的部署。

准备工作

确定服务器配置

在部署PHP网站之前,首先需要确定服务器的配置,PHP网站需要以下环境:

(1)操作系统:Linux或Windows

(2)Web服务器:Apache、Nginx等

(3)PHP版本:根据需求选择合适的版本

(4)数据库:MySQL、MariaDB等

购买域名和空间

为了使网站能够被访问,需要购买一个域名和相应的空间,国内知名的域名注册商有阿里云、腾讯云等,空间提供商有阿里云、西部数码等。

搭建环境

安装操作系统

根据服务器硬件配置选择合适的操作系统,Linux系统推荐使用CentOS、Ubuntu等,Windows系统则选择Windows Server。

安装Web服务器

以Apache为例,安装Apache的方法如下:

(1)在Linux系统中,使用以下命令安装Apache:

yum install httpd

(2)在Windows系统中,从Apache官网下载Apache安装包,按照提示完成安装。

安装PHP

(1)在Linux系统中,使用以下命令安装PHP:

yum install php

(2)在Windows系统中,从PHP官网下载PHP安装包,按照提示完成安装。

安装数据库

以MySQL为例,安装MySQL的方法如下:

(1)在Linux系统中,使用以下命令安装MySQL:

yum install mysql-server

(2)在Windows系统中,从MySQL官网下载MySQL安装包,按照提示完成安装。

配置Web服务器

以Apache为例,配置Apache的方法如下:

(1)编辑Apache配置文件(/etc/httpd/conf/httpd.conf),找到以下行:

LoadModule php5_module modules/libphp5.so

(2)在配置文件中添加以下行,以支持PHP:

AddType application/x-httpd-php .php

(3)重启Apache服务:

systemctl restart httpd

上传网站文件

  1. 将网站文件上传到服务器上的指定目录,如 /var/www/html。

  2. 配置网站域名解析

在域名解析服务商处,将域名解析到服务器的公网IP地址。

测试网站

  1. 在浏览器中输入网站域名,查看网站是否正常显示。

  2. 检查网站功能是否正常,如数据库连接、图片显示等。

上线优化

  1. 优化网站代码,提高网站性能。

  2. 配置缓存,加快网站加载速度。

  3. 部署SSL证书,保障网站安全。

  4. 定期备份网站数据,以防数据丢失。

通过以上步骤,您已经成功部署了一个PHP网站,在实际部署过程中,可能还会遇到各种问题,需要根据实际情况进行调整,希望本文能为您提供一些帮助,祝您网站部署顺利!

标签: 全攻略 搭建 部署

上海衡基裕网络科技有限公司,网络热门最火问答,网络技术服务,技术服务,技术开发,技术交流www.wdyxwl.com 备案号:沪ICP备2023039794号 内容仅供参考 本站内容均来源于网络,如有侵权,请联系我们删除QQ:597817868